Frequently asked questions
- What was Tagar Culture?
- An Iron Age culture that developed in the Minusinsk Basin, characterized by the kurgan tradition, animal-style art, and the production of bronze and iron weapons.
- When did Tagar Culture exist?
- 700 BCE – 100 BCE
